Beringia Farallon Wool Shirt

  • Materials: 70% wool, 15% Polyester, 10% Acrylic, 5% Nylon
  • Fabric weight: 21oz
  • Garment weight: 19 oz.
  • Fit: Loose and oversized. Size down if you want a closer fit
  • Best for: Cool-weather work shirt and winter sports

Pros

  • Meticulously crafted from fiber to stitch in Bishu, Japan
  • Warm and breathable
  • Giant zippered mesh chest pocket secures goods
  • Meshed gussets behind the shoulders unlock the arms and vent heat when breaking a sweat

Cons

  • Could use two snaps around the wrist to better prevent warm air from funneling out
  • Top button is small and hard to manipulate through the fat-in-the-hand fabric
  • Single hand pocket on the left is limiting, but we appreciate the “Easy-Rider” backstory
  • Limited brick and mortar shops to try before you buy.
